I just got a 98 gt, had a really bad rod knock. I opened her up, and it had not one, but two bad bearings!

I've just ordered Sean Hylands 4.6 how to book, but wanted some additional opinions.

Yes getting forged this and that is gonna help for strength, but if the weak link is the bearings, what to do about that? Is it a common problem? I plan on staying NA, but would like to make it reliable, perhaps more reliable than stock...

Thanks!
 
heh, in my searching it actually seems pretty common. Strange that cop cars and taxi's go for hundreds of thousands of miles...

So I recieved my "bible" from Sean Hyland, it seems despite the lower strength of the aluminum block, the 4 bolt main is very appealing to fight future possible bottom end issues. According to the book, the aluminum bottom end is good for over 1000 horsepower, so for my measely 300hp desires, it sounds like my best option.
